At Hisor Central Stadium, Tajikistan emerged from a two-goal deficit to tie with Iran 2–2. The outcome made the home fans proud of their team’s determination while putting Iran on track for the final in one of the CAFA Nations Cup’s most dramatic group matches.
Tajikistan vs Iran Match Summary
Category | Details |
Teams | Tajikistan vs Iran |
Final Score | Tajikistan 2-2 Iran |
Date & Venue | September 4, 2025 - Hisor Central Stadium |
Key Moments | Mohebi 38', 47'; Samiev 58'; Dzhuraboev 78' |
Man of the Match | Zoir Dzhuraboyev (Tajikistan) |
Tournament Impact | Iran top Group B and reach the final, Tajikistan eliminated |
Goal Breakdown
- 38’ – Iran 1–0 Tajikistan
Scorer: Mohammad Mohebi
Mohebi broke the deadlock with a smart finish inside the box.
The opener gave Iran the early advantage in this CAFA Nations Cup clash.
- 47’ – Iran 2–0 Tajikistan
Scorer: Mohammad Mohebi
Just after the restart, Mohebi struck again with another composed finish.
Iran looked to be in complete control of this CAFA Nations Cup encounter.

- 58’ – Iran 2–1 Tajikistan
Scorer: Shahrom Samiev
Assist: Parvizdzhon Umarbaev
Samiev pulled one back with a clinical strike that lifted the crowd.
The goal gave Tajikistan hope and shifted the momentum.
- 78’ – Iran 2–2 Tajikistan
Scorer: Zoir Dzhuraboev
Assist: Parvizdzhon Umarbaev
Dzhuraboev found space and placed his shot perfectly to equalize.
The comeback was complete and the stadium erupted.
CAFA Nation Cup Key Incidents
- 41’ – Yellow Card (Iran): M. Ghorbani booked for a late challenge.
- 69’ – Yellow Card (Tajikistan): S.Samiev booked for another foul.
- 69’ – Yellow Card (Iran): A.Jahanbakhsh also booked for foul.
- 87’ – Yellow Card (Tajikistan): P. Umarbaev penalized for a tactical foul.
Performance Highlights
- Mohammad Mohebi (Iran): Clinical in front of goal with a first-half brace.
- Shahrom Samiev and Zoir Dzhuraboev (Tajikistan): Inspired the comeback with crucial strikes.
- Turning Point: Tajikistan’s first goal changed the mood of the match completely.
Miss of the Match: Tajikistan squandered a golden chance early in the second half that could have leveled the game sooner.
Post-Match Impact of CAFA Nation Cup
- Iran: Finished on top of Group B and proceeded to the CAFA Nations Cup final.
- Tajikistan: On head-to-head, they were eliminated despite a brave comeback.
